Approach-Avoidance Bias in Virtual and Real-World Simulations: Insights from a Systematic Review of Experimental
Aitana Grasso-Cladera1, John Madrid-Carvajal1, Sven Walter1
1Institute of Cognitive Sciences, Osnabrück University, 49090 Osnabrück, Germany.
Virtual reality (VR) offers an ecologically valid way to study approach and avoidance bias (AAB) in naturalistic settings. Developing a coherent framework for VR-based AAB research is crucial for advancing interventions and promoting balanced behaviors.
Area of Science:
- Psychology
- Cognitive Science
- Human-Computer Interaction
Background:
- Approach and avoidance bias (AAB) reflects automatic reactions to emotional stimuli.
- Traditional AAB studies often lack ecological validity.
- Investigating AAB in naturalistic contexts presents methodological challenges.
Purpose of the Study:
- To systematically review the use of virtual reality (VR) and real-world setups for studying AAB.
- To summarize methodological innovations and challenges in AAB research.
- To evaluate the alignment of experimental designs with research objectives.
Main Methods:
- Systematic review of peer-reviewed articles using VR and real-world setups for AAB research.
- Analysis of experimental designs, stimuli, response metrics, and technical aspects.
- Identification of limitations and methodological coherence.
Main Results:
- 14 studies were included, showing diverse methodologies and response metrics.
- Variability in VR technology application and participant interaction paradigms was observed.
- Discrepancies between simulated and natural actions were noted; few studies included control conditions or physiological data.
Conclusions:
- VR provides a promising ecologically valid setup for studying AAB with dynamic interactions.
- A coherent framework for VR-based AAB research is essential for advancing the field.
- Addressing foundational challenges in VR design will lead to more reliable paradigms and effective interventions for bias modification.
